New Delhi [India], April 12: The entity[“product”,”POCO C85x 5G”,”smartphone 2026″] has entered the market, positioning itself not as a performance beast, but as a reliable, long-lasting companion for everyday tasks. Priced at Rs 10,999, this phone targets users who prioritize connectivity, battery life, and long-term value over flagship power.
Performance for the Everyday Grind
The POCO C85x 5G isn’t designed to compete with gaming flagships, but it delivers a smooth experience for everyday tasks. The octa-core processor, paired with 4GB of RAM, handles social media scrolling, email, and GPS navigation with ease. While heavy gaming isn’t its strong suit, it’s not meant to be. It’s a solid choice for those who need reliability without needing to push performance boundaries.
The highlight is the software support. Running on Android 16 with HyperOS 3, POCO promises an impressive 4 years of OS updates. In a budget segment where phones are often abandoned after a year or two, this long-term commitment ensures users can rely on the device until 2030, offering great value.
Entertainment on a Giant Screen
The POCO C85x 5G shines as a media companion thanks to its massive 6.9-inch display. Despite a noticeable chin at the bottom, the 120Hz adaptive refresh rate elevates the user experience. Whether you’re binge-watching shows or browsing, the display feels fluid and engaging.
Battery Life: The True Star
If one feature defines the POCO C85x 5G, it’s the 6300mAh battery. It’s a marathon runner. Even with heavy usage—streaming, social media, and navigation—the phone easily lasts a full day, with enough left over for the next morning. This makes it an ideal choice for users who don’t want to be tied to a charger.
While the 15W charging isn’t the fastest by today’s standards, the immense battery capacity means you won’t have to top up often.
Camera and Design: Functional and Practical
The 32MP dual rear camera setup is modest but effective. In good lighting conditions, it produces clear and shareable photos. It’s not meant to rival flagship cameras, but it delivers on expectations for its price range.
Physically, the phone balances a large battery while staying surprisingly slim at 8.15mm. It’s comfortable to hold and has practical touches such as a 3.5mm headphone jack—rare in modern phones—and a microSD slot that supports up to 2TB of expandable storage.
